Since I don't know the Ry Cooder recording, I cannot say for sure that it is exactly the same tune, but Fiddlin' Sam Long recorded Seneca Square Dance in either January or February of 1926. He is generally considered to be the first Ozark musician to record. The song is available on Echoes Of The Ozarks, Volume One, County 3506, 1995. The album is an excellent anthology of mostly Arkansas musicians recorded 1926-1933.

Another good version, derived from Long's, is by Geoff Seitz of St. Louis on his The Good Old Days Are Here CD, Oceana 003. It is not as widely available, but you can get it through Elderly.
